News Central Govt Approves Chandrayaan-5 Mission To Study Moon: ISRO Chief The Chandrayaan mission consists of studying the lunar surface. Chandrayaan-1 successfully launched in 2008 took chemical, mineralogical and photo-geologic mapping of the Moon.
